A suspension of 4-[4-(3-pyrrolidin-1-ylpropoxy)phenyl]tetrahydro-2H-pyran-4-carboxylic acid (23.5 g, 0.0636 mol) in methanol (235 ml, 10 vol) was stirred and cooled to 0 to −5° C. under nitrogen. Thionyl chloride (9.3 ml, 0.1272 mol, 0.40 vol) was charged dropwise over 20 minutes, maintaining the temperature at −5 to +5° C. The resulting slurry was then heated and stirred at reflux under nitrogen for 16 h after which time LC analysis showed 1.4% by area of acid remaining. The solution was evaporated to dryness in vacuo at 40° C. to give a brown sludge. The sludge was dissolved in ethyl acetate (118 ml, 5 vol) and water (235 ml, 10 vol) and the layers separated. The aqueous layer was washed with ethyl acetate (118 ml, 5 vol) and basified to pH 11 with saturated aqueous potassium carbonate (118 ml, 5 vol). The product was extracted into dichloromethane (3×118 ml, 3×5 vol) and the combined extracts dried over magnesium sulfate (23 g) and concentrated in vacuo at 40° C. to yield methyl 4-[4-(3-pyrrolidin-1-ylpropoxy)phenyl]tetrahydro-2H-pyran-4-carboxylate (21.7 g, 98% from the nitrile) as a cream solid.
